Understanding Qualification Verification & Its Challenges

Qualification​ verification is the process of ⁤authenticating degrees, certifications, and skills claimed by an individual. Traditionally, this involves manual procedures,⁤ third-party agencies, and endless paperwork. Common challenges include:

  • Credential Fraud: Fake certificates, diploma mills, and‌ resume padding are rampant.
  • Time-Consuming: Manual verification can delay hiring and admissions processes.
  • Error-Prone: Paperwork can be lost, and databases are not always interoperable.
  • Data privacy: Sharing sensitive documents thru insecure channels risks exposing personal information.

How Blockchain Transforms Credential ⁢Verification

⁤ Blockchain introduces a paradigm shift for education, employers, and learners by ​offering a new way⁤ to issue, store, and share academic and professional ‍certificates. Here’s how:

1.‌ Immutable Records

⁣ Once a credential is issued on the blockchain, it cannot be altered or ‍forged. This ensures the highest level of credibility for academic degrees and professional certifications.

2. Instant and Borderless Verification

⁤ Institutions and​ employers can instantly verify a candidate’s qualifications without relying on intermediaries​ or outdated processes, even across international borders.

3. Enhanced Privacy and Control

Individuals retain ownership of thier digital credentials and decide who⁤ can access their information, ⁣aligning with modern data‍ privacy ⁤standards such as GDPR.

4. seamless⁤ Integration​ With Digital Identity

blockchain-based credentials integrate effortlessly with digital ID platforms, streamlining everything from university⁤ admissions to employment applications.

Real-World Examples & Case Studies

Many leading institutions and companies worldwide have already⁤ adopted or piloted blockchain-based qualification verification systems. Here are some notable examples:

  • MIT Digital Diplomas: The Massachusetts institute of Technology (MIT) offers blockchain-secured ⁤digital diplomas to graduates. Employers or institutions can verify authenticity instantly via a QR code or blockchain explorer.
  • Europass Digital credentials: The european Union’s Europass initiative uses blockchain to issue and verify tamper-proof digital credentials for education and training.
  • APPII and Learning Machine: These platforms partner ⁣with universities and companies to provide blockchain-backed credentialing⁤ solutions, improving trust in hiring and admissions.
  • National‍ Blockchain ​Projects: Some countries have launched nationwide efforts to manage educational qualifications​ using blockchain-based verification—for example,malta’s government certification system.

FAQs about Blockchain and Qualification Verification

  • Is a blockchain diploma legally valid?

    ‍ Absolutely.Most blockchain diplomas‍ are issued by accredited ⁣institutions and recognized like paper certificates.

  • What about ‌privacy concerns?

    Personal data is encrypted ⁣and not stored publicly; only the credential and its authenticity are on-chain.

  • How can an ‌employer verify a blockchain credential?

    ‍ Usually via a secure link, QR code, or a blockchain verification ⁣platform provided by the issuer.
